For instance, should a child sustain an injury on the community playground and the parents decide to sue the Association, you may be liable for a portion of the costs. This could protect you in the event the Associations insurance is insufficient to cover the community expenses related to a covered loss. As a part-owner of these amenities, it is partly your responsibility to pay for accidents or liabilities that may occur in community areas.
